The Role & Expectations
As a Groundsman or Greenkeeper, you will play a crucial role in the maintenance and enhancement of outdoor spaces, whether that be pristine sports fields, local parks, or botanical gardens. Your work ensures that these areas are not only aesthetically pleasing but also safe and functional for the community. This role is especially important in the UK, where green spaces contribute significantly to public health, environmental sustainability, and community engagement.
Your day-to-day responsibilities will vary depending on the season and specific site requirements, but you can expect to engage in a range of tasks that are both physically demanding and rewarding. You will be responsible for the cultivation and maintenance of turf, which involves tasks such as mowing, aerating, and fertilizing to ensure optimal grass health. Additionally, you will need to be vigilant in monitoring for pests and diseases, implementing environmentally-friendly pest control measures when necessary.
In this role, you will also be tasked with the preparation of sports pitches for matches and events. This includes marking out lines, setting up goalposts, and ensuring that the surface is in peak condition. Attention to detail is paramount, as the quality of the playing surface can significantly impact the performance of athletes and the enjoyment of spectators.
